It has been revealed that PJ Harvey played a secret surprise gig for her hometown ahead of her performance at Glastonbury 2024.

On Thursday (June 27), the musician surprised the residents of Bridport, Dorset â the town where she grew up near and is a resident in â to a show at the Abbotsbury Subtropical Gardens on the Jurassic Coast.
The gig served as a warm-up for her Glastonbury set and was kept under wraps with the exception of notices posted in Bridport town centre. The only way to purchase a ticket was by showing up in person and buying one from the Bridport Arts Centre or Bridport Tourist Information Centre.
The following day (June 28) Harvey took over the Pyramid Stage at the annual Worthy Farm music bash and opened her set by enlisting artist Marina AbramoviÄ to deliver a speech to the crowd before encouraging them to participate in a seven-minute silence.

The artist asked the crowd to put a hand on their neighbour and participate in the silence â which was brought in by Emily Eavis ringing a gong. AbramoviÄ then opened her arms to reveal a dress in the shape of a giant peace sign.
Writing about Harvey’s performance for NME‘s Glastonbury 2024 liveblog, journalist Jordan Bassett wrote: “The show started with an arty video that featured, as well as other outrĂ© images, a clip of a man pointing a bow and arrow at a woman who was complicit in the act â and things were about to get even artier. With the Pyramid Stage crowd expecting PJ Harvey to appear for her early evening set, conceptual and performance artist Marina AbramoviÄ instead arrived to lead a seven-minute silence, a moment of peace amid the ‘violence’ and ‘killing’ in the world.
He continued: “It was a truly moving occasion (not least due to the number of Palestinian flags clustered near the front of the crowd) and the sense of hushed reverence carried over to Harveyâs set. The ghostly keys on âLet England Shakeâ and the experimental cacophony of âThe Glorious Landâ seemed to take on a new delicacy in this context. Ever-mercurial, though, Harvey soon swerved into the grindhouse grunge of â50ft Queenieâ and the insidious squall of âBlack Hearted Loveâ.
“If the set petered out a little after that with the understated âTo Bring You My Loveâ, it was like a return to the eerie quietude from which it came. This was a meditative show in an era thatâs often anything but.”
Earlier this summer, Harvey used her performance at Primavera Sound 2024 to pay tribute to the late record producer Steve Albini, who produced her second studio LP, 1993âs âRid Of Meâ.
While performing in Barcelona, she said: âI would like to sing this next song in memory of Steve Albini. Steve should have been here for this festival, and it would be nice if you all think of him.â Harvey then performed âThe Desperate Kingdom Of Loveâ from 2004âs âUh Huh Herâ.
